Bakewell tart
/ (ˈbeɪkwɛl) /
Save This Word!
noun
British an open tart having a pastry base and a layer of jam and filled with almond-flavoured sponge cake

Word Origin for Bakewell tart
C19: named after Bakewell, Derbyshire
